We show that the univalent local actions of the complexification of a compact connected Lie group K on a weakly pseudoconvex space where K is acting holomorphically have a universal orbit convex weakly pseudoconvex complexification. We also show that if K is a torus, then every holomorphic action of K on a weakly pseudoconvex space extends to a univalent local action of KC.

We show that Martin Hyland's effective topos can be exhibited as the homotopy category of a path category $\mathbb{EFF}$. Path categories are categories of fibrant objects in the sense of Brown satisfying two additional properties and as such provide a context in which one can interpret many notions from homotopy theory and Homotopy Type Theory. We show by elementary means that every Kan fibration in simplicial sets can be embedded in a univalent Kan fibration. Mathematics Subject Classification 55R15 · 55R35 · 55U10 · 18C50
